Output ce91c6562e6206f3b4fe002d3c7d6de3c4f9efd7122054e1022c8af535e4a623:0

value
104893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f37b8fe42605ab9eb77791f8a521f7d90cf5f7 OP_EQUAL
address
384tEFaWCdMA7r9frwzkPsWzB8uVva9pPW
transaction
ce91c6562e6206f3b4fe002d3c7d6de3c4f9efd7122054e1022c8af535e4a623
confirmations
174171
spent
true